Double or Nothing is a turn-based strategy roguelite built around multiple customizable spinning boards.
Start with a simple table and turn it into your own machine. Add new segments, upgrade high-value wedges, buy relics, and decide when to take risks. Every spin can score points, generate gold, heal, add shields, or punish you with curses.
Face escalating antes, survive dangerous House Moves, and defeat a boss at the end of each ante. Clear tables to push deeper through the roster, then unlock Hell Mode for a harder version of the full game.
